The Evolution of the Chanel Flap Bag: A Legacy of Innovation
Before exploring the specific 2018 models, it's crucial to understand the Chanel flap bag's historical context. The bag, conceived by Gabrielle "Coco" Chanel in the 1950s, revolutionized handbag design. Its structured silhouette, iconic quilting, and the signature interlocking CC clasp cemented its status as a timeless classic. Over the decades, Chanel has subtly evolved the design, introducing variations in size, material, hardware, and functionality. The addition of a top handle in 2018 was one such evolution, offering a sophisticated alternative to the traditional shoulder strap.
Chanel Flap Bag with Handle 2018: Design Variations and Features
The 2018 collection featured several variations of the flap bag with a handle. While specific model numbers may vary, the common thread was the inclusion of a top handle, often crafted from leather or metal chains, alongside the classic shoulder strap. This dual functionality allowed for greater versatility, enabling the wearer to carry the bag in hand or over the shoulder, depending on their preference and outfit. Sizes ranged from the petite mini flap to the more spacious jumbo, catering to individual needs and carrying capacity.
The Chanel Mini Rectangular Flap Bag with Handle (2018): A Refined Elegance
One particularly noteworthy example from 2018 was the mini rectangular flap bag with a handle. This smaller version retained the classic elements of the flap bag – the quilted leather, the CC clasp, and the chain strap – but added the refined touch of a top handle. Its compact size made it ideal for evening events or as a stylish everyday accessory for carrying essentials. The rectangular shape offered a slight departure from the more traditional square or slightly trapezoidal shapes of other flap bag variations, lending a modern and sophisticated aesthetic. This model often featured lambskin leather, known for its softness and luxurious feel.
The Chanel Top Handle Bag Small (2018): A Blend of Classic and Contemporary
The "Chanel Top Handle Bag Small" designation, while not an official model name, accurately describes a range of smaller flap bags from 2018 that prioritized the top handle. These bags often incorporated a more structured design compared to their more slouchy counterparts, reflecting a contemporary trend towards more defined silhouettes. The smaller size made them perfect for everyday use, allowing the wearer to carry the essentials without excess bulk. The material choices varied, with options including lambskin, caviar leather (known for its durability), and even exotic skins in limited-edition releases.
